Hawthorn Avenue is in Colchester and in Colchester district. CO4 3XB is located in the Greenstead elect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Colchester.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Hawthorn Avenue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Hawthorn Avenue was 921.0 per 1,000 residents, which is 480.3% higher than the Greenstead average. The most reported crime type was Shoplifting.

Hawthorn Avenue has the highest crime rate of 80 local areas in Greenstead and the 7th highest crime rate of 619 local areas in Colchester .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 223.4 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-58.3%.
